The Concept and Technology
The idea of virtually tasting food may sound like something out of a science fiction movie, but researchers and engineers are actively working to make it a reality. The underlying principle of this technology lies in stimulating the taste and sensory receptors in our brains to create the perception of taste without the need for physical consumption.
The key technology behind this concept is a combination of virtual reality (VR) and haptic feedback systems. With the help of VR headsets and gloves, users can immerse themselves in a virtual environment that replicates the appearance and ambiance of a restaurant. As they explore the digital menu, the haptic feedback system comes into play. It generates realistic sensations on the user's fingertips, simulating the textures and temperatures of the food they choose.
Simultaneously, the VR headset stimulates the user's senses of sight and smell, presenting visually appealing and aromatic representations of the dishes. By combining these sensory inputs, the technology tricks the brain into experiencing a virtual taste sensation that closely mimics the real thing.
Advantages and Implications
The introduction of technology that allows the virtual tasting of food carries numerous advantages and implications. Firstly, it can provide a personalized and interactive dining experience for individuals with specific dietary requirements or restrictions. Vegans, vegetarians, or those with allergies can preview and select dishes that cater to their needs without any uncertainties.
Furthermore, this technology has the potential to reduce food waste significantly. By allowing users to sample dishes virtually, they can make more informed decisions about their orders. This eliminates the risk of ordering something they may not enjoy or finish, leading to a decrease in discarded food items.
Additionally, the virtual tasting experience can serve as a tool for culinary exploration. Users can experiment with unfamiliar or exotic dishes without the fear of wasting money on a potentially unsatisfactory meal. This opens up new possibilities for cultural exchange, as people can discover and appreciate diverse cuisines from around the world.
Challenges and Limitations
As with any emerging technology, there are challenges and limitations associated with virtually tasting food. One of the primary obstacles is the accurate replication of taste sensations. While the technology can simulate textures and temperatures, fully capturing the complex flavors and nuances of different dishes remains a significant challenge. Taste is a subjective experience influenced by various factors, including individual preferences and cultural backgrounds, making it difficult to create a universally satisfying virtual taste.
Another limitation is the lack of multisensory integration. While the technology focuses on stimulating the visual, tactile, and olfactory senses, it cannot replicate the full range of sensory experiences associated with a physical dining experience. Factors like ambiance, social interactions, and the overall atmosphere of a restaurant are currently beyond the scope of virtual tasting technology.
